摘要
A broadband circularly polarised antenna with a compact structure is proposed based on a microstrip-coplanar waveguide (CPW) fed rectangular slot antenna. The wideband feeding network power divider (PD) consists of a Wilkinson PD and a 90 degrees phase difference comparator. The even modes of four CPW feed lines are generated to provide equal amplitudes but in phase quadrature. Circular polarisations can be excited over a very broad frequency band. A reflector is added to the antenna structure to improve the antenna gains. The inverted configuration, which places the reflector in the slot side, is ultilised to enhance the impedance matching. The measured impedance bandwidth for |S-11|<-10dB is 74.4%. A broad 3-dB axial ratio bandwidth of 70.8% is also obtained. The measured 3-dB gain bandwidth is 53.65% with the peak gain of 7.4dBic.
